Chrissy Parker (played by Maggie Lawson) is the "freak of the week" in the Smallville episode "Redux". She is a student at Smallville High School who possessed the bizarre ability to absorb the youth from others, causing her victims to age rapidly and herself to remain young. How she acquired this power is unknown except that she had it long before the meteor shower over Smallville, so her ability is in no way related to kryptonite like most of the series' early antagonists.

Chrissy's true age is unknown, though her parents died over a hundred years before she moved to Smallville, Kansas. After two consecutive cases of students rapidly aging and dying, Clark Kent and Chloe Sullivan begin investigating the possible cause. Chloe's investigation reveals a number of cases of advanced progeria leading back as far as 1921 and discovers old photographs of Chrissy under a different name. For decades, Chrissy has been using her power to absorb the life energy of others to keep herself youthful and has repeatedly changed her identity as she moves to different towns across America, hoping to live what she considers to be the best years of a person's life forever.

Chrissy confronts Principal Reynolds in the theatre hall of the Talon where the Spirit Week festival is to be held. Reynolds has been unable to contact Chrissy's family and Chrissy's stolen youth is wearing off, causing her to age rapidly. She decides to absorb the Principal's life next, but Clark finds her and stops her before she can go through with it. Clark shoves Chrissy away, and as she gets back up, she looks at her reflection in a revolving mirror cube that was part of the decor for the festival. As the mirror cube rotates, Chrissy watches her face wither in each side of the cube. In seconds, she ages so rapidly that her body deteriorates into a pile of dust.
